solve the equation:
4x^2 + 2x - 20 = 0
---------------------
Divide thru by 2 to get:
2x^2+x-10 = 0
2x^2+5x-4x-10 = 0
x(2x+5)-2(2x+5) = 0
(2x+5)(x-2) = 0
x = -5/2 or x=2
